Data for "Full Microscopic Simulations Uncover Persistent Quantum Effects in Primary Photosynthesis"

This data set accompagnies the manucript Lorenzoni N., Lacroix T., Lim J., Tamascelli D., Huelga S. F. & Plenio M. B., Full Microscopic Simulations Uncover Persistent Quantum Effects in Primary Photosynthesis, arXiv:2503.17282, https://doi.org/10.48550/arXiv.2503.17282 (2025). This dataset can be cited as Lorenzoni, N., & Lacroix, T. (2025). Data for "Full Microscopic Simulations Uncover Persistent Quantum Effects in Primary Photosynthesis" [Data set]. Zenodo. https://doi.org/10.5281/zenodo.16894519. It contains DAMPF data: Fenna-Matthews-Olson excitation energy transfer (FMO EET) electronic density matrix dynamics data at T = 77 K and T = 300K (Figures 3, 4, S2, S3) 2D spectra simulations of a dimeric unit at T = 77K (Figures 5, S5, S6) and T-TEDOPA data: dimer simulation results at T = 77 K and T = 300 K (Figure S1) code to run the dimer simulation at T = 77 K and T = 300 K chain coefficients for the FMO spectral density at T = 77 K and T = 300 K
